P0201 on 2010-2014 GMC Terrain: Injector Circuit Malfunction Causes and Fixes
P0201 on a 2010-2014 GMC Terrain indicates an electrical fault with the cylinder 1 fuel injector. The most common cause is a failed fuel injector, a known issue on these engines. A wiring harness issue is also a strong possibility. Expect to pay $50-$120 for a replacement injector.
- P0201 is an electrical circuit code for the cylinder 1 fuel injector, not a misfire code, though it will cause a misfire.
- The most likely cause on a 2010-2014 Terrain is a failed fuel injector, but wiring should be inspected carefully.
- A simple way to confirm a bad injector is to swap it with an adjacent cylinder and see if the trouble code follows the injector to the new cylinder.
- These vehicles use low-resistance GDI injectors; do not misdiagnose them as shorted based on resistance values from older port-injected cars.
What's Unique About the 2010-2014 Gmc TERRAIN
The 2010-2014 GMC Terrain, with either the 2.4L Ecotec or the 3.0L/3.6L V6, uses a direct injection (GDI) fuel system. These systems operate under very high pressure and the injectors are a known point of failure. Unlike older port injectors which have a resistance of 11-16 ohms, these GDI injectors have a much lower resistance, typically around 1.1 to 2.0 ohms. This can lead to misdiagnosis by technicians unfamiliar with GDI systems. While TSB #PIP4924D lists P0201 among many misfire-related codes, other bulletins for similar GM platforms specifically call out chafing wiring harnesses as a primary cause for injector circuit codes.

Symptoms You May Notice
- Check Engine Light is on
- Rough or shaking idle
- Engine misfiring or stumbling
- Hesitation and loss of power during acceleration
- Reduced fuel economy

- Replacing the spark plug or ignition coil for cylinder 1. While these parts can cause a misfire code (P0301), the P0201 code specifically indicates an electrical fault in the fuel injector's circuit, not the ignition system.
- Misdiagnosing a good GDI injector as bad. Technicians accustomed to older port injectors with 12-16 ohm resistance may see a 1.5-ohm reading on a V6 GDI injector and incorrectly assume it is shorted.
Most Likely Causes
- Faulty Cylinder 1 Fuel Injector 🔴 High Probability → Shop Fuel Injector Direct injectors on this platform are a widely documented failure point, leading to various fuel and misfire codes.
How to confirm: Swap the cylinder 1 injector with another cylinder (e.g., cylinder 2). If the code changes to P0202, the injector is confirmed bad. Alternatively, check the injector's internal resistance with a multimeter. For the 3.0L/3.6L V6 GDI injectors, the resistance should be very low, between 1.5 and 2.5 ohms. For the 2.4L GDI engine, the spec is typically higher, around 11-14 ohms. An open circuit (OL) or a reading significantly different from the other injectors indicates failure. A standard port injector reading (11-16 ohms) would be incorrect for the V6 engines.

Est. part cost: $50-$120 - Wiring Harness or Connector Issue 🟡 Medium Probability GM has issued service bulletins for other models with similar engines regarding chafed wiring harnesses causing injector circuit codes. The harness can rub against brackets or other engine components, eventually breaking the wire or causing a short.
How to confirm: Visually inspect the wiring and connector at the cylinder 1 injector for corrosion, pushed-out pins, or physical damage like chafing. Trace the harness as far back as possible. Use a 'noid light' to verify the PCM is sending a pulse signal to the connector. If the noid light doesn't flash, the problem is in the wiring or PCM.
Typical fix: Repair the damaged section of the wire or replace the injector connector pigtail. Protect the repaired harness from future damage using convoluted tubing or by rerouting it.

How to confirm: This is diagnosed by exclusion. If the injector and wiring have both been tested and are known to be good (i.e., the injector has correct resistance and the wiring has continuity with no shorts to ground or power), the injector driver circuit inside the PCM is the likely culprit.
Typical fix: Replace and reprogram the PCM.

Diagnosis Steps
- Connect an OBD-II scanner to confirm P0201 is the primary code and check for other related codes like P0301.
- Identify Cylinder 1. On the 2.4L 4-cylinder, it is the cylinder on the passenger side. On the 3.0L/3.6L V6, it is the front-most cylinder on the firewall side (Bank 1).
- Visually inspect the electrical connector and wiring going to the cylinder 1 fuel injector. Look for any signs of corrosion, damage, or loose connections. Pay close attention to where the harness might rub against brackets or hoses, as noted in GM TSBs for similar platforms.
- Test for a pulse signal from the PCM using a noid light. Disconnect the injector connector and plug in the noid light. Start the engine. - If the noid light does not flash, test the injector resistance. Disconnect the injector and use a multimeter set to ohms. A good GDI injector for the V6 engine should read between 1.5 and 2.5 ohms. The 2.4L engine injector should read between 11 and 14 ohms. If it reads as an open loop (OL) or is significantly different from the other injectors, it has failed.
- The simplest confirmation test is to swap the cylinder 1 fuel injector with the cylinder 2 injector. Clear the codes, run the engine, and re-scan. If the code changes to P0202, the fuel injector is faulty and must be replaced.
- If the code P0201 returns after the swap, the problem is in the wiring or the PCM. Test the wiring harness for continuity from the injector connector to the PCM connector and check for shorts to ground or power.
- If the injector and wiring are confirmed to be good, the fault likely lies within the PCM's injector driver circuit.

Related Codes That Often Appear With This One
- P0301 — P0301 means 'Cylinder 1 Misfire Detected'. Since the P0201 code indicates the injector isn't firing, a misfire on that same cylinder is a direct and expected consequence.
- P0300 — This code means 'Random/Multiple Cylinder Misfire'. It can appear alongside P0201 if the underlying electrical issue (like a bad ground or harness chafe) is intermittently affecting other cylinders or if the engine is running very poorly.
- P2146, P2149 — These codes relate to the injector group supply voltage (e.g., 'Fuel Injector Group A Supply Voltage Circuit/Open'). TSB PIP4924D mentions these codes in conjunction with individual injector circuit codes, suggesting a wiring harness issue could affect an entire bank of injectors.

Platform-Specific Known Issues
- High Rate of Injector Failure: Both the 2.4L and V6 engines in this generation of Terrain and its Chevy Equinox sibling are known for fuel injector problems that can cause misfires and set various codes, including P0201.
- Carbon Buildup (2.4L Engine): The 2.4L direct injection engine is susceptible to heavy carbon buildup on the intake valves. While this does not directly cause an electrical code like P0201, it frequently causes misfires (P0300) and can be discovered at the same time as a faulty injector.
- Wiring Harness Chafing: On similar GM platforms with related engines, the engine wiring harness has been known to chafe on brackets, particularly near the rear of the engine or near the ECM, causing shorts or open circuits that trigger injector codes.
Mechanic-Grade Diagnostic Values
- Fuel Injector Coil Resistance (3.0L/3.6L V6 GDI) — expected: 1.5 - 2.5 ohms. Failure: A reading near zero (short), infinity/OL (open), or a value significantly different from other injectors.
- Fuel Injector Coil Resistance (2.4L I4 GDI) — expected: 11 - 14 ohms. Failure: A reading near zero (short), infinity/OL (open), or a value significantly different from other injectors.
- Injector Power Wire Voltage (Key On, Engine Off) — expected: ~12 Volts (Battery Voltage). Failure: Voltage significantly below battery voltage points to high resistance in the power supply circuit or a fuse issue.
- Low-Side Fuel Pressure (Engine Idling) — expected: 345-690 kPa (50-100 psi). Failure: Pressure outside this range indicates a problem with the in-tank fuel pump module or its control circuit.
Scan Tool Commands That Help
- GDS2 (GM Dealer Software): Fuel Injector Balance Test — This command individually fires each injector while monitoring fuel rail pressure drop. It can help identify a mechanically faulty (clogged/leaking) injector that may not have a clear electrical fault, or confirm a flow issue after an electrical fix. A pressure drop for one injector that varies more than 20% from the average indicates a problem.
Wiring & Ground Locations
- G112 — On the 2.4L engine, it's at the lower left front of the engine. On the 3.0L V6, it's at the left rear of the engine.. This is a primary engine ground point used by the Engine Control Module (ECM) and various sensors. A poor connection here can cause erratic behavior and incorrect readings, potentially leading to false injector circuit codes.
- G105 — On the 2.4L engine, it's at the rear of the engine. On the 3.0L V6, it's at the left rear of the engine.. This is another critical engine ground. Verifying it is clean and tight is a key step in diagnosing any electrical fault on the engine, including injector circuits.
- Injector Connector (X160 on 3.0L) — Directly on each fuel injector.. The control signal from the ECM for injector 1 ('Fuel inj 1 ctrl') terminates here. This is the primary point for testing with a noid light, checking for power, and measuring injector resistance. The connector itself or its terminals can corrode or break.

Model Year Variations Within This Range
- 2010-2012 vs 2013-2014: For the 2013 model year, the optional V6 engine was changed from a 264-hp 3.0L (LF1) to a more powerful 301-hp 3.6L (LFX). While the P0201 diagnostic logic is the same, technicians should be aware of which V6 they are working on as some components may differ.
